If you're not lifted or on bigger tires, you shouldn't HAVE to adjust your lights. With that said, the factory may have misaligned them, so it's a good idea to check if you're getting flashed a lot.
I prefer solid tops to shades. The shades don't do you much good if there's a pop-up rain shower.
I tried the Mopar top, but it was flappy at anything over 35 and wouldn't stay in place like it should.
